Abstract

Dengue fever is an infectious disease spread by the bite of the Aedes mosquito, especially Aedes aegypti. The fact that the Aedes aegypti mosquito often bites during the day during school activities, makes schools a potential location for the spread of DHF. To stop the spread of dengue fever, clean and healthy living behavior (PHBS) can be implemented by washing hands properly, keeping classrooms clean, eating healthy food, exercising regularly, and getting enough sleep. Other efforts are wearing a mask when in crowds, maintaining a safe distance, and using 3M-plus to prevent dengue, such as draining, covering, and burying. The purpose of this service is to educate junior high school students in Tambosupa Konawe Selatan Village about maintaining a clean school environment and avoiding various diseases, especially DHF, to increase their knowledge and skills regarding clean and healthy behavior (PHBS).
